Did New mRNA Melanoma Data and AI Partnerships Just Shift Merck’s (MRK) Investment Narrative?
Merck & Co., Inc. MRK | 120.87 | +0.02% |
- In recent days, Merck and Moderna reported five-year follow-up data showing that their personalized mRNA melanoma therapy, when combined with Keytruda, substantially lowered the risk of recurrence or death in high-risk patients.
- This clinical milestone, alongside new collaborations in AI-driven drug discovery, diagnostics, and vaccine development, reinforces Merck’s push to broaden its oncology and infectious disease platforms beyond Keytruda.

What Is Merck's Investment Narrative?
To own Merck today, you have to believe its push to build a broader oncology and infectious disease engine can gradually rebalance the business away from Keytruda while still justifying a premium for its high margins, strong free cash flow and long dividend record. The new five‑year melanoma data with Moderna’s mRNA therapy, plus fresh alliances in AI drug discovery, diagnostics and vaccines, slot directly into that story by sharpening near‑term catalysts around the oncology pipeline rather than changing it outright. Recent collaborations with Guardant, Illumina’s Billion Cell Atlas and CEPI on an improved Ebola vaccine all point to Merck trying to translate its cash flows into a deeper, tech‑enabled pipeline, even as analysts still flag the late‑decade Keytruda patent cliff, high debt levels and some policy risk around vaccines as the main overhangs.
